  • Skirmish Mode: This mode can be played online and offline. You get three fire teams of three members each. Fire team members can be made up of human players or AI. The goal is to 'clear' the map of enemy AI. It can be compared to Terrorist Hunt mode in the Rainbow Six games. (Source:IGN Preview)

I wonder why people think firefight is going to be a spamfest. That simply isn't possible considering how the firearms in RO work. You might be able to sprint out of cover or pull some Rambo stuff with a StG when most of the enemy team can only take a single shot from their bolt action, but when they've all got at least semi-autos that tactic becomes suicidal. I imagine it will be more like Insurgency, where even peeking around a corner is quite life threatening due to the fact everyone has an automatic rifle.

So basically, you're going to have to be MORE cautious and methodical on firefight mode. That's the only way you can succeed in RO under any circumstances, unless your opponents are unbelievably horrible.
